Description

A kind of stackable section bar transport vehicle
Technical field
Small-sized transporting equipment is the utility model is related to, more particularly to a kind of stackable section bar transport vehicle.
Background technology
Section bar refers to according to certain standard, using artificial material to standardize, the material of large-scale production manufacture.In section bar During production, for convenience of transporting and using, shape extrusion is generally produced into the length of standard, when section bar transports, bulk transport Car cannot be introduced into workshop, outdoor can only be transported to by travelling bogie, but remove again and again using existing travelling bogie It is low to transport efficiency comparison, can only once transport the section bar of a car, the section bar of single transport is fewer, and the manpower of consuming is relatively more, Cost of transportation is higher.
Utility model content
The purpose of this utility model is to provide a kind of stackable section bar transport vehicle, can drop the height of travelling bogie It is low, laminated multi-layer is carried out, energy single transports more section bars, improves the efficiency of transport.
Above-mentioned purpose of the present utility model technical scheme is that:
A kind of stackable section bar transport vehicle, including base and the column positioned at four edges of base, the column are The hollow square tube of upper end open, column upper end outer cover are equipped with opening up enlarging set, and the lower end of the column is less than The position of base, which is extended, the intubation to match with column upper end internal via shape.
By using above-mentioned technical proposal, because section bar transport vehicle bicycle freight volume is less, in the column of transport vehicle Upper end sets enlarging set, and column lower end sets intubation, can easily be inserted into the intubation of a transport vehicle by enlarging set The column upper port of another transport vehicle, spacing connection is carried out using intubation and column, two or more transport vehicles are carried out Successively stack up and down, section bar is placed on Multilayer transport vehicle, improve the section bar freight volume of single, improve conevying efficiency.
Preferably, the enlarging set includes the pyramid cylinder and lower end and the prism cylinder of column suit of upper end size gradation, The minimum diameter of the pyramid cylinder is identical with the internal diameter of column.
By using above-mentioned technical proposal, enlarging set upper side is that gradual opening becomes big pyramid cylinder, can be moved to intubation In pyramid cylinder, convenient intubation is aligned by pyramid cylinder and column upper port, is intubated to that can be dropped into just after good position It is easy to use in stud openings.
Preferably, separated in the column, the two sections of the column are connected by inner sleeve, the inner sleeve Multigroup relative sleeve pipe connection hole is offered on relative side, is provided with what multigroup and sleeve pipe connection hole coordinated on the column Column connecting hole.
By using above-mentioned technical proposal, column it is Height Adjustable, make the Height Adjustable of section bar transport vehicle, pass through drop The height of low column, the transport vehicle of more layers can be stacked, further improve the freight volume of single transport section bar.
Preferably, the base includes long margin frame along its length and short frame in the width direction, the long side The end of frame and short frame is fixed on column, and the column offers column slot on the side relative with long margin frame, described Column slot is inserted with long side plate.
By using above-mentioned technical proposal, long side plate is fixed by column slot between column, prevents section bar from transport Slid on car, while the installation of long side plate is more convenient.
Preferably, it is fixed with several connections along strut length direction on the column side relative with short frame Gusset, short side plate is fixed with the connecting rib.
By using above-mentioned technical proposal, short side plate is fixed by connecting rib in transport vehicle rear and front end, prevents section bar Slid in transport vehicle front and back end, while short side plate is fixed by connecting rib and column, is firmly installed, and is able to take short side plate The shock at section bar both ends.
Preferably, the long side plate and short side plate are wooden composite plate.
By using above-mentioned technical proposal, long side plate and short side plate uses wooden composite plate, can mitigate transport vehicle Weight, convenient transport vehicle of artificially carrying is stacked layer by layer, while reduces the production cost of transport vehicle.
Preferably, the base lower surface is fixed with wheel, the lower surface of the intubation is higher than the lower end of wheel.
By using above-mentioned technical proposal, intubation is higher than wheel, does not interfere with the rotation of wheel and the motion of transport vehicle, make Transport vehicle works smooth when transporting section bar.
In summary, the utility model has the advantages that:The utility model can by section bar transport vehicle mounted on top, Improve the freight volume of single.Enlarging is set to cover and be intubated in the column upper and lower side of transport vehicle, convenient transport vehicle up and down is led To positioning, upper and lower transport vehicle quickly can be subjected to contraposition connection.Side plate is set in the surrounding of transport vehicle, section bar when preventing from transporting It can be slid out of transport vehicle.

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ing.
A kind of stackable section bar transport vehicle, as shown in Figure 1, including be spliced into by the more bodys being connected anyhow Base 1, bedplate is equipped with base 1, base 1 is provided with long margin frame 11 along its length, is provided with along its width Short frame 12, long margin frame 11 and short frame 12 are orthogonal, are fixed in long margin frame 11 with the position that the end of short frame 12 is intersected There is the column 2 vertical with base 1, four root posts 2 are arranged on the corner location of base 1.Pacify on the downside of the both ends of two long margin frames 11 Equipped with wheel 4.
When it is implemented, column 2 is the hollow square tube for being divided into three sections, including column body 201, lower prop 202 and inner sleeve 23, the both ends of inner sleeve 23 are inserted respectively into column body 201 and lower prop 202, and column body 201 and lower prop 202 are connected Column 2 is formed together.With reference to Fig. 1 and 2, it is provided with the side relative with long margin frame 11 of column 2 and runs through column 2 from top to bottom Column slot 25, the rectangular long both ends of side plate 31 are inserted in column slot 25, and the following of long side plate 31 is against long margin frame 11 On.Column body 201 and lower prop 202 on the identical side of column slot 25 with being welded with connecting rib 26, connecting rib 26 It is oppositely arranged along the length direction of short frame 12, short side plate 32 is fixed on connecting rib 26 by bolt or screw.Wherein Long side plate 31 is identical with the height of short side plate 32, trolley is formed the closed loading compartment of surrounding.
Connected as shown in Fig. 2 the lower end of column body 201 is provided with the column being arranged above and below with the upper end of lower prop 202 Hole 24, column connecting hole 24 are located on column 2 and 12 length direction identical of short frame, two sides, on inner sleeve 23 with column The sleeve pipe connection hole 231 of multiple oblongs is provided with the relative side of connecting hole 24, four bolts pass through column connecting hole 24 and sleeve pipe connection hole 231 column body 201, lower prop 202 and inner sleeve 23 are linked together.
The upper end of column body 201 is set with opening and is more than 2 open-ended enlarging of column set 21, the lower end of lower prop 202 Intubation 22 is welded with, the outer wall and the inwall of the end of column body 201 for being intubated 22 match, and intubation 22 can pass through expansion Muzzle 21 is inserted into the upper end of column body 201, and the rubber shock-absorbing sleeve 221 of square tube shape is set with intubation 22.
See accompanying drawing 3, enlarging set 21 is enclosed at the upper port of column 2, and enlarging set 21 includes two parts, first, gradually opening upwards Mouthful become big pyramid cylinder 211, first, with the isometric wide prism cylinder 212 in 211 minimum port of pyramid cylinder, set on the inwall of prism cylinder 212 There is a ladder platform, after enlarging set 21 is enclosed on column 2, the inwall at 211 minimum port of pyramid cylinder can be neat with the inwall of column 2 It is flat.
As shown in Figure 4, wheel 4 and vehicle wheel frame 41 collectively constitute universal wheel, and vehicle wheel frame 41 is rotatably installed in wheel installation The lower surface of seat 5, wheel mounting seat 5 is rectangular plate body, and one end of wheel mounting seat 5 is rotatably connected on by jointed shaft 56 On the downside of long margin frame 11, wheel mounting seat 5 can rotate around jointed shaft 56, turn on the other end upper side of wheel mounting seat 5 Dynamic to be connected with a connecting rod 51, the other end of connecting rod 51 is rotatably connected on the downside of long margin frame 11, to strengthen wheel Cushioning ability, connecting rod 51 uses pneumatic spring, when wheel mounting seat 5 can rotate around jointed shaft 56, connecting rod 51 Also it can rotate and shrink around the position being hinged with long margin frame 11.
In order to reach more preferable damping effect, damping spring 52 is set with connecting rod 51, the both ends of damping spring 52 are supported Touch on elastic sheet metal 53, elastic sheet metal 53 be U-shaped elastic metallic, the opening direction phase of two elastic sheet metals 53 Instead, the biside plate of elastic sheet metal 53 has transverse slat 54, the horizontal stroke of two elastic sheet metals 53 to both sides are extended during specific implementation Plate 54 contradicts on the upper side of the downside of long margin frame 11 and wheel mounting seat 5 respectively.In order to avoid elastic sheet metal 53 around Connecting rod 51 is rotated, and guide 55, guide 55 are fixed with the upper side of the downside of long margin frame 11 and wheel mounting seat 5 It is the U-board being stuck on transverse slat 54, guide 55 limits elastic sheet metal 53 and can only moved back along the length direction of long margin frame 11 It is dynamic.Transport vehicle is passing through rough road surface, it may occur that pitches, when dolly falls, wheel mounting seat 5 acts in pressure Under can around jointed shaft 56 rotate be rotated up, connecting rod 51, damping spring 52 and elastic sheet metal 53 can be compressed to realize damping Effect.
With reference to accompanying drawing 3 and 5, now two travelling bogies are stacked together, in order to reduce stack rear dolly height, it is necessary to First adjusting post 2, the height of monomer dolly is reduced, change the less long side plate 31 of width and short side plate 32, it is then that top is small The intubation 22 of car is inserted into the enlarging set 21 of lower section dolly, and intubation 22 can slide and be fastened on vertical along the skew wall of enlarging set 21 In the upper port of post 2, rubber shock-absorbing sleeve 221 can be stuck in enlarging set 21, certain cushioning effect is played, by the four of top dolly After individual intubation 22 is inserted into the enlarging set 21 of lower section dolly, dolly stacks installation, can carry out the transport of section bar.
